Displayed as a companion to “Gotcha,” this strip reveals the truth behind Steve’s suspicion: Frank the Janitor is not guilty of mischief, but instead hosting a tea party for a child patient. Wearing a washcloth skirt and a flower‑strewn hat, Frank sips tea poured from a hospital pitcher, while a pillow with a rubber‑glove face joins the scene. The child, beaming in a hospital gown, transforms the sterile setting into a kingdom of kindness through imagination and play.


Though this reproduction is not an original, it completes the story and honors the grace we witnessed during Randy’s recovery. It brings tears not only for its beauty, but for the truth it reflects: that compassion, humor, and humanity can flourish even in the hardest of places.
